This information is available from the SPACE archive, located on
ames.arc.nasa.gov.  The file named "manifest.01.90.short" contains a list
of shuttle missions and payloads.  Additional files contain descriptions
of the individual payloads.  The archive may be accessed either via
anonymous ftp (directory /pub/SPACE), or by a mail response system (send
mail to archive-server@ames.arc.nasa.gov, with a subject of "help").
